DIAGNOSTIC ITEM 15: Diagnose the lines between CAN main bus line and the SRS-ECU.
CAUTION
When servicing a CAN bus line, ground yourself
by touching a metal object such as an unpainted
water pipe. If you fail to do so, a component con-
nected to the CAN bus line may be damaged.
.
TROUBLE JUDGMENT
If the MUT-III cannot received signals from the
SRS-ECU, CAN bus line connector(s) are broken or
an open circuit has occurred.
.
COMMENTS ON TROUBLE SYMPTOM
The wiring harness wire or connectors may have
loose, corroded, or damage terminals, or terminals
pushed back in the connector, or the SRS-ECU may
be defective.
.
TROUBLESHOOTING HINTS
• Refer to circuit diagrams GROUP-
• Refer to configuration diagrams GROUP-
• The wiring harness or connectors may have
loose, corroded, or damage terminals, or termi-
nals pushed back in the connector
• The SRS-ECU may be defective

DIAGNOSIS
Required Special Tool:
• MB991223: Harness Set
STEP 1. Check joint connector C-02 and SRS-ECU
connector C-121 for loose, corroded or damaged
terminals, or terminals pushed back in the connector.
CAUTION
The strand end of the twisted wire should be within 10 cm
(4 inches) from the connector. For details refer to
Q: Are joint connector C-02 and SRS-ECU connector C-121
in good condition?
YES : Go to Step 2.
NO : Repair the damaged parts. Replace the joint
connector as necessary.
